Medical detox
If you need help stopping alcohol or other substances safely, you'll begin with medically monitored detox, with 24/7 nursing support to ease withdrawal symptoms. Length of stay is individualized to your needs.
Residential treatment
After detox, you'll move to residential care, which includes individual therapy, group sessions, family therapy, and time to reflect and heal. Length of stay is individualized to your needs.

Many clients face co-occurring mental health challenges like depression, anxiety, post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), or bipolar disorder. Depending on your needs, you may engage in therapies including:
- C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T)
- Trauma therapy
- Motivational interviewing (MI)
- Life skills training
If medication-assisted treatment is appropriate, you may receive medications like Suboxone, Subutex, or Vivitrol alongside counseling to manage cravings and support your recovery.
What to bring
- Comfortable clothing and everyday hygiene products
- Medications and medical history
- Contact information for loved ones
Please leave behind any substances, valuables, or items that may distract from your recovery. If you're not sure what's allowed, our admissions team is happy to walk you through it before you arrive.
